 Chilliwack Corn Maze

This year, Chilliwack Corn Maze is changing things up at the the 12-acre attraction, with the creators of the maze paying special tribute to the Canucks 50th anniversary season, with a Canuck-themed maze.

When: Until October 31.

Where:  41905 Yale Road West, Chilliwack

Time: Tuesdays to Saturdays from 11 am to 9 pm, and Sundays and holidays from 11 am to 6 pm.

Admission: Tickets for the attraction are $9.75 for children (ages 3 to 14), and $11.75 for adults (ages 15+).

Maan Farms Haunted Corn Maze

The 45-minute experience deemed the ‘scariest corn maze in Canada’ takes place on over five-acres on the farm, featuring terrifying installations, live actors, real chainsaws, and excerpts from classic horror movies.

When: September 21 to October 31

Time: Daily 7 to 10pm

Where: 790 McKenzie Rd Abbotsford

Admission: $20 early bird, $30 at the door

Bose Farms Corn Maze

This maze, which sits on 17 acres of Bose Farm’s 25 total acres, features a design honouring Scouts Canada. This year there is also a night maze happening at Bose Farms in case you wanted to get your spook on. When you find your way out of the winding paths of corn, be sure to visit the farmer’s market or pick the perfect pumpkin.

When: September 4 to October 14

Time: Reserved groups Monday to Friday (during the day)
Reserved groups Monday to Thursday (Evenings)
Friday night 6 to 8 pm
Saturday 12 to 8pm
Sunday and Thanksgiving Monday 12 to 4pm

Where: 64th Avenue and 156th Street, Surrey

Admission: $7.50 per person, $25 for a family of four

Laity Corn Maze

This corn maze at Laity Pumpkin Patch is perfect for kids at just one acre. On their adventure, they’ll also get to meet the Cornstone family that lives in the maze. As well as the maze, you’ll also find a whole host of pumpkin patch activities happening this October.

When: September 28 – October 31, 2019

Time: Monday to Friday 12pm to 5pm, Saturday & Sunday 9am to 5pm

Where: 21145 128th Avenue, Maple Ridge

Admission: $7 per person

Taves Family Farms

Each year, the 12-acre maze gets a new design, and the farm’s range of activities are expanded. This year, you’ll also be able to enjoy a giant jumping pillow, pedal kart track, indoor hay bale maze, and a corn box and tons of fun family activities included with admission.

When: September 28 – October 31

Time: Sunday to Wednesday 9 am to 5:30 pm
Thursday, Friday & Saturday 9 am to 6:30 pm

October 31, 9 am to 5 pm

Where: 333 Gladwin Road, Abbotsford

Admission: $7.50 per person or $36.50 for a family

Port Kells Corn Maze

This Corn Maze has loads of the twists and turns. And if you head down to this nursery in October, you’ll also be able to go on a tractor ride, visit the chicken coop, enter the goat palace, get spooked in the haunted house and then search for the best pumpkin.

When: Every day

Time: 9 am to 6 pm

Where: Port Kells Nurseries – 18730 88 Avenue, Surrey

Admission: Free.
